Hays Education is seeking enthusiastic KS1 Supply Teachers to cover in Whitstable primary schools.

The role offers flexibility with day-to-day and short-term supply, immediate start, and opportunities across Year 1 and Year 2.

Ideal candidates hold QTS or are working toward it, with experience in KS1 and strong classroom management.

Competitive daily rates and ongoing support are provided by Hays Education.
